Abstract

A process is provided for preparing ammonium tungstate. In the process, a reduced calcium tungstate is treated in the presence of an oxidizing agent with an aqueous solution having at least ammonium cations and carbonate and/or bicarbonate anions, at a temperature of 10.degree. C to the boiling point of the solution. The reduced calcium tungstate reacts with the ammonium cations to form the ammonium tungstate which is soluble in the solution and with the anions to form a calcium compound which is insoluble in the solution. Oxygen and/or hydrogen peroxide are preferred oxidizing agents. The process is especially useful in separating tungsten values from scheelite ores or concentrates.
